Grant Making Trust The Hilden Charitable Fund

WebThe Hilden Charitable Fund was established in 1963 by Joan and Tony Rampton. It is a grant-making foundation registered with the UK Charity Commission, Charity Registration Number: 232591. The Hilden Charitable Fund awards grant to projects both in the UK and in developing countries. http://www.nonprofitfacts.com/NC/Holden-Family-Charitable-Foundation.html WebCharity registered in Scotland SC003558. Hilden Charitable Fund Resource Centre

WebThe Hilden Charitable Fund is an endowed grant-making foundation and a registered charity. We fund smaller UK-based organisations delivering projects within the UK to support … Applications will only be accepted using the online application form.
